SPECIFICATIONS
Data taken at VDRF = 3 V, VDLO = 3 V, LO = −4 dBm ≤ LO ≤ +4 dBm, −40°C ≤ TA ≤ +85°C, with a Mini-Circuits® QCN-45+ power
splitter for both upper sideband (low-side LO) and lower sideband (high-side LO), unless otherwise noted.
